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K, filed on October 22, 2004, reports the unaudited results of operations for PNM Resources, Inc. and its subsidiary Public Service Company of New Mexico for the three and nine months ended September 30, 2004. PNM Resources is an energy holding company serving approximately 460,000 natural gas and 405,000 electric customers in New Mexico, with additional wholesale power sales in the Western U.S.
Key Financial Metrics
- Quarterly Earnings (Q3 2004): GAAP net earnings were $27.4 million ($0.45 per diluted share), compared to $16.6 million ($0.27 per diluted share) in Q3 2003.
- Year-to-Date Earnings (9 months 2004): GAAP net earnings were $1.13 per diluted share, compared to $1.36 per diluted share in the same period of 2003.
- Ongoing Earnings: Q3 2004 ongoing earnings were $0.45 per share (up 2.3% from Q3 2003). YTD 2004 ongoing earnings were $1.13 per share (up 3.7% from YTD 2003).
- Gross Margin: Consolidated gross margin for Q3 2004 decreased $10.7 million (6.3%) year-over-year. YTD consolidated gross margin was $490.8 million, a decrease of $6.6 million (1.3%) from the prior year.
- Interest Expense: Interest expense decreased in both the quarter and full year due to refinancing activities.
- Costs: Coal costs declined in Q3 and YTD 2004. Operating costs were controlled despite higher plant maintenance costs associated with planned outages.
Material Changes Versus Prior Period
- Weather Impact: Cooler weather in Q3 2004 reduced cooling degree days by over 28% quarter-over-quarter and 21% year-to-date, dampening retail and wholesale margins and sales volumes.
- Rate Changes: An electric rate decrease implemented in September 2003 negatively impacted gross margins, partially offset by a gas rate increase effective January 2004.
- Non-Recurring Items: Q3 2003 included a one-time charge of $0.17 per share for early debt retirement. YTD 2003 included a non-cash gain of $0.62 per share and one-time charges of $0.35 per share. No one-time items were reported in Q3 or YTD 2004.
- Operational Performance: Favorable operating performance at the San Juan plant and strong weather-adjusted electric load growth (4%) partially offset margin declines.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
- 2004 Guidance: PNM Resources narrowed its 2004 ongoing earnings guidance to a range of $1.35 to $1.45 per share.
- Management Commentary: Management attributes the earnings increase to lower interest charges, controlled operating costs, and declining coal costs, despite margin pressure from weather and rate changes.
- Risks and Contingencies: The filing highlights risks related to the proposed acquisition of TNP Enterprises, including regulatory approval, integration challenges, and market conditions. Other risks include weather variability, fuel costs, wholesale power prices, and regulatory decisions.
